TICKET #— Missed pick-up, spare parts for Hollow Ridge relay site

Hey dispatch, the courier never showed yesterday for the crate of gearbox spares bound for the Hollow Ridge station. The site techs are down to one working actuator, so this is now urgent. Crate is still sitting at the Farrowgate parts counter, labelled and strapped. Please rebook for tomorrow morning at the latest and confirm back here. One more thing for whoever rides along: the hand-over instruction below is confidential, so pass it to the courier verbally only.

handover note for yagef-bagep: the drudor pelius courier leaves the kasdor zorvan norir ledger at gate 8016 under passcode 755406

# Feedproof client setup.
# Validates podcast RSS against the Castwarden ruleset before publish.
# Timeouts are deliberately short (2s) — the validator is synchronous
# in the publish path. Don't raise them without talking to the pipeline
# crew. The client authenticates to Castwarden with the key below.

API key for kahop-bagef: zpat2_yb

## FinchSearch Environments — Nightly Reindex

For the release manager: the nightly reindex runs in all three FinchSearch environments, but only prod actually swaps the live alias. Dev reindexes a 5% sample, staging does a full run against last week's snapshot, and prod rebuilds from the Marrowgate catalog at 02:00. If a release lands mid-reindex, the job restarts cleanly, so don't panic — just note it in the release log. The prod reindex job currently runs with these configuration values:

service settings:
[briius]
port = 3000
region = outer-1
host = briius.zarqeldyn.internal
team = wenael
timeout_ms = 2000
retries = 5

Welcome to the Quillhaven catalogue import! Once a night we pull the full record dump from the Fernbrook library consortium and merge it into our search index. It's mostly boring, but the dedupe step occasionally chokes on records with missing publication years — you'll see a stalled job alert. Usually a retry fixes it; if not, skip the batch and flag it for the data team. The troubleshooting guide is here.

operations page: https://jenkins.zemvarcloud.local/job/merge_requests/repo/build/73930b4b30f0a8ed